I've been taking a migraine rx for years, first Imitrex (sp?) but that made me super nauseous! So now I take Zomig which only makes me a tiny bit nauseous for a few minutes. However it's spendy since I was getting a migraine every other to every few days. And without an Rx they stick around for about 3 days and are pretty much debilitating. I even tried botox for them but the migraines figured that out and moved down into my eye socket away from the botox. Sigh. And no OTC meds will help if one has already started. My doctor heard that B2 could help with migraines and suggested I take it daily. OMG! After about a week and a half they were gone! Seriously it was like a miracle! I'd had them since I was a child and nothing ever worked to prevent them. Not that this is perfect, they do break through about once every few months, especially if I forget to take the B2 one day or when I watch a 3D movie. I just keep the Zomig on hand for that. I am so grateful for this miracle I had to share and hope it helps someone else with a similar situation! Tried some other brands but this one seems to deliver the best results. I began taking B-2 supplements several years ago when when my neurologist recommended Migrelief (an OTC preparation that contains feverfew, riboflavin and magnesium) to help manage my chronic migraine headaches. To my relief - no pun intended - the Migrelief did ease some of my migraine symptoms, as well as produce another most unexpected side effect; the almost total clearing of my lifelong eczema.I mean, my hands went from being itching, weeping, cracking messes that I loathingly resorted to slathering in steroid cream constantly just for peace, to calm, healing skin in less than a week of taking the pills. I was thrilled, of course, but amazed that no doctor had ever recommended any kind of supplement to help cure my eczema.Obviously, I wondered which ingredient specifically triggered the remission, but didn't find out until the Migrelief supply on the Amazon Subscribe & Save program became unsteady, and since it was virtually unavailable locally, I decided that it was silly not to simply purchase the ingredients separately. This Nature's Way B-2 was the most economical way to get the 400 milligram daily dosage of riboflavin that is in Migrelief.For the purpose of experimentation, I began the individual supplements separately, and this is when I learned that it is the riboflavin that suppresses my eczema symptoms.
